The first viral product that I thought of are the Drunk Elephant Bronzing Drops. These actually launched back in June of 2018. They originally came in a tube, and then they ended up repackaging them more recently into the little dropper style bottle that they have now. When they kind of relaunched them, they all of a sudden went viral really just in the last year or so, but they’ve been around for quite some time. It’s sort of fascinating that a product that’s been out for about 6 years now only started going viral last year. But more recently a ton of different brands have come out with dupes. We have Pacifica, ELF, Tarte, Glow Recipe, Physicians Formula, everybody seems to be copying these in 2024.
Flower Beauty Heatwave Bronzing Drops
Even several years ago, back in, I think it was 2020, Flower Beauty had launched The Heatwave bronzing drops. Flower Beauty had an almost identical product to the Drunk Elephant way before they even went viral. But there is one drugstore product that’s been out even longer than all of them, and that’s…

LOreal True Match Lumi Glotion
The LOreal True Match Lumi Glotion was way ahead of the trends when it launched in January of 2018, about 6 months before the original drunk elephant. This product comes in four or five different shades to match different skin tones, with instructions to use a lighter shade for highlighting and a deeper shade for an all-over bronze effect. By mixing it with foundation or body lotion, it gives a believable bronze glow reminiscent of a sun-kissed vacation, without the negative effects of sun exposure.

Tubing Mascara Trend
Thrive liquid lash extensions inspired a whole host of brands to make their own tubing formulas. Brands like e.l.f., Milani, Hourglass, and CI Ray have all come out with their versions. Despite its recent popularity, the liquid lash extensions concept has been around since 2017. However, there is one tubing formula that has been at the drugstore since 2009, and that’s the L’Oreal Double Extend Beauty Tubes Mascara.
Double Extending Beauty Tubes Mascara
This mascara is not just a tubing mascara; it also comes with a lengthening primer with fibers on the other side. It offers a two-in-one kind of deal, which has been appreciated by many users over the years. While some may prefer the more dramatic look of Thrive’s tubing mascara, L’Oreal’s version provides a more natural result. It gives a ton of length without smudging or flaking, and it’s effortless to remove with just water, no need for a cleanser.

The Rise of the Tarte Maracuja Juicy Lip
In contrast, the tarte maracuja juicy lip launched in June of 2020, but it was not until 2021 or 2022 that it truly gained momentum and went viral in the beauty community. This product, known for its hydrating and juicy finish, inspired a wave of copycats and dupes from various drugstore brands like e.l.f, NYX, Colourpop, Flower Beauty, and about face. The popularity of these melty lip balms in click pen-style applicators was a testament to their effectiveness and desirability.
Revlon Glass Shine Lipsticks
Revlon’s Glass Shine Lipsticks were way ahead of the trends when they launched earlier in 2020. Unlike traditional lipsticks, these have a melty texture that resembles a lip gloss in a stick. They offer tons of shine and feel super hydrating on the lips, giving off a glossy finish that is both elegant and moisturizing.
Glossy Shine in a Stick
What sets the Revlon Glass Shine Lipsticks apart is their glossy shine in a stick form. The twist-up style packaging makes them convenient to use, and the melting quality of the formula turns them into a hydrating oil upon contact with the skin. They provide a sheer hint of color while maintaining a smooth and comfortable feel on the lips.

Skin Tints: Neutrogena Hydro Boost Hydrating Tint
You probably already have them in your collection already and if you don’t they’re, incredible, definitely worth checking out and much less expensive. Another huge Trend that we’ve been seeing over the past couple of years are skin tints. I think every brand from drugstore to high end is coming out with skin tints.
They became a little bit more of a big deal after the pandemic when everybody was starting to just wear less makeup in general and go for a more natural look but there’s one skin tint that I have been loving since it came out in 2017 and that’s The Neutrogena Hydro Boost Hydrating Tint.
This has been my Holy Grail, favorite, skin tint and every single one that I’ve tried does not measure up to this one for me, and I think part of the reason is because a lot of the newer ones, especially at the drugstore, have a lot of alcohol in the formula – and they just make my skin look really dried out.
This Hydroboost one is alcohol free and it just makes my more mature 46-year-old skin, look so much more plump and dewy and just more hydrated. It kind of fills in those Fine Lines. A little bit more makes them less noticeable and it just leaves a sheer wash of color. So if I find myself needing a little more coverage, I’ll use this and then just add a concealer in the spots that I need it usually under my eyes and around my nose.
